Wood with a hard knot can be used in structural applications, but there are specific limits to consider due to the potential impact on the wood's strength and integrity. Knots in wood can significantly affect its mechanical properties; they may reduce tensile strength, impact resistance, and load-bearing capabilities. However, if the knot is small and the overall strength requirements are still met, the wood may be deemed acceptable for certain structural applications.

Evaluation and adherence to engineering and building codes are crucial when using wood with knots. Designers and engineers must ensure that the structural load can still be safely supported despite the presence of knots, which means assessing the size, type, and location of the knot within the wood. If the specifications allow for it and the knot does not compromise the integrity of the structure, then it is permissible to use such wood with prescribed limitations.
